MBC Youth offers an exciting opportunity for your Jr. High and Sr. High student to experience true community and fellowship with others. We provide a clean, safe, and fun environment where students experience a live worship band, a game or crazy ice-breaker activity, a life lesson about the God of the Bible, and then the students break into community groups to discuss the lesson they just heard as they learn to apply these truths from the Bible to their daily lives.
The Sr. High Youth Group meets on Sunday Nights, from 6:00 to 8:00 PM at MBC.
Our desire is to teach the truths of God to the next generation, engage with students, equip them with Gospel truth and expand the Kingdom and Glory of God here on Earth until the Lord’s return.
The goal for the High School Youth is to ensure that love and truth are central to our program. We want kids to come and feel welcomed and cared for by their peers and wise adults from MBC. We want kids to come and learn about the truth.
- Who is God?
- What has He done?
- How is He to be worshipped?
- Where can I find actual joy?
